Output 84c4574c86b5016c64e4e868a25697e1988e4121ee32a722eea61fe9fcdebff7:1

value
15096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b5b7a37b9b75f4007fcf0030a0b9d5cd36997d2 OP_EQUAL
address
3LEGgSuJPGzrF9x3gxKh9CPYZ5ECcooGtC
transaction
84c4574c86b5016c64e4e868a25697e1988e4121ee32a722eea61fe9fcdebff7
confirmations
215407
spent
true